Otc - Active Ingredient
Active Ingredient - Ethyl Alcohol 62% v/v
Otc - Purpose
Purpose - Antbacterial Agent
Indications & Usage
Uses - Hand sanitizer to help reduce bacteria on the skin that could cause disease.
Warnings
Warnings
For external use only.
Flammable. Keep away from heat or flames.
Avoid contact with eyes. If eye contact occurs, flush with water.
Stop use if, in rare instances, redness or irritation develop. If condition persists for more than 72 hours, consult a physician.
Otc - Keep Out Of Reach Of Children
Keep out of reach of children. If swallowed, contact a physician or poison control center.
Dosage & Administration
Directions
Apply small amount to palm. Briskly rub, covering hands with product until dry.
Inactive Ingredient
Inactive Ingredients - Water, PEG-10 Dimethicone, Glycerin, Isopropyl Myristate, Polyquaternium-11, Disodium EDTA, Aloe Barbadensis Leaf Juice, Tocopheryl Acetate.
